The Environmental Challenges of Running Gear

Performance apparel is predominantly composed of polyester, nylon, and spandex, materials derived from fossil fuels. The production of these textiles is resource-intensive, consuming significant quantities of water and energy while also contributing to carbon emissions. Furthermore, each washing cycle releases microplastics—microscopic plastic fibers—into wastewater systems, which ultimately infiltrate rivers and oceans, posing a severe threat to marine ecosystems.
